Why Do Traditional Lead-Acid Batteries Underperform for the Hyster OSX15?

Lead-acid units for the Hyster OSX15 require 24V or 36V configurations with 400-800Ah capacities, but their 80% efficiency leads to 7-9 hour overnight charges. Weekly electrolyte checks and equalization add 2 hours of labor per week.

Deep cycling causes sulfation, cutting runtime to 5-6 hours under continuous 2,500 lb lifts. Weight exceeds 2,200 lbs, straining truck stability during high reaches.
